interdire la suppression de ligne sauf dans une macro

  • Initiateur de la discussion Initiateur de la discussion ptibaz
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

ptibaz

XLDnaute Junior
Bonjour Bonjour !

Mon but est d'interdire la suppression de ligne mais pas dans une macro.
Actuellement j'ai :

Private Sub Worksheet_Change(ByVal Target As Range)

If Target.Columns.Count = Columns.Count Then

Application.EnableEvents = False
MsgBox "Suppression ligne annulée" & vbCrLf & " " & vbCrLf & "Utilisez la fonction masquer. MERCI", vbExclamation, " NE PAS SUPPRIMER LES LIGNES "
Application.Undo
Application.EnableEvents = True
End If

End Sub


mais quand je suprime une ligne dans une mcro ca plante...

Comment faire ???
 
Re : interdire la suppression de ligne sauf dans une macro

en plus dans ce fichier , les mises en forme conditionnelles ne se mettent pas a jour instantanément. On dirait que l'écran ne se rafraichit pas.
Quand on choisi un type en colonne D, la colonne C change de couleur.
Pourquoi c'est pas instantané ?
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
3
Affichages
590
Retour